PCB announced PSL 5 remaining matches schedule in November

The Pakistan Cricket Board (PCB) today announced the schedule for the remaining four HBL Pakistan Super League 2020 matches, which were postponed on March 17th due to a Covid-19 pandemic.

The four games will be played in Lahore on November 14, 15 and 17, with only Qualifier and Eliminator 1 having a double header. Eliminator 2 will be played the next day, with the event ending on Tuesday, November 17.

Dates will be set after consultation and discussions with the four players - Multan Sultans, Karachi Kings, Lahore Qalandars and Peshawar Zalmi - while starting times will be confirmed closer to the event.

The final four games of the event will be played according to Covid-19 protocols, including a biosafe bubble for players, match officers and event staff. The games would currently be played behind closed doors. However, the situation will be closely monitored and will be reviewed in October.

Of the four teams represented in the remaining matches of the HBL PSL 2020, only Peshawar Zalmi is a former winner who won the cup in Lahore in 2017. This not only makes these four matches more exciting, but also fills fans with expectation.

HBL PSL 2020, Pakistan's biggest cricket spectacle since the 2008 Asian Cup, has a total of $ 1 million in prize money, including a $ 500,000 winning prize, a stunning brand new trophy and $ 200,000 for second place.

Saturday, November 14 - Qualification (Multan Sultans v Karachi Kings), Gaddafi Stadium; Eliminator 1 (Lahore Qalandars vs Peshawar Zalmi) Gaddafi Stadium

Sunday, November 15 - Eliminator 2 (Qualifier for losers vs. Eliminator 1 winner); Gaddafi Stadium

Tuesday, November 17 - Final; Gaddafi Stadium Lahore
